Understanding the Versatility: More Than Just a Coin Purse
The term "coin purse card holder" might seem limiting, but these Chanel pieces are far more than just receptacles for change. They often seamlessly blend the functionality of a coin purse with the practicality of a card holder, making them ideal for everyday use. Many designs feature multiple card slots, allowing you to carry essential credit cards, identification, and even a few folded bills. This compact yet capacious design makes them perfect for those who prefer a minimalist approach to carrying their essentials without sacrificing functionality. The zipped closure ensures the security of your belongings, adding an extra layer of peace of mind.
Exploring the Variations: A Range of Styles and Sizes
The Chanel universe offers a diverse range of coin purse card holders, catering to various tastes and preferences. While the core functionality remains consistent—a zipped compartment for coins and slots for cards—the designs themselves exhibit a fascinating variety:
* Zipped Coin Purse Chanel: This is the most basic yet ubiquitous iteration. Often featuring the iconic quilted leather, these purses are compact and easily slip into a larger bag or pocket. The zip closure adds a touch of sophistication and security.
* Authentic Chanel Wallet: While not all Chanel wallets are explicitly labeled as "coin purse card holders," many smaller wallets seamlessly incorporate both coin and card storage. Authenticity is paramount, and recognizing genuine Chanel pieces is crucial (more on this later).
* Chanel Zippy Coin Purse: The "zippy" designation often refers to a slightly larger version of the standard zipped coin purse, offering more space for both coins and cards. These are ideal for those who need a bit more carrying capacity.
* Chanel Passport Wallet: Although designed to hold a passport, many Chanel passport wallets also incorporate slots for cards and a zipped compartment for coins, effectively functioning as a sophisticated travel companion.
* Chanel Zipped Wallet Small: This category encompasses a range of small zipped wallets that prioritize compact design while still providing ample space for essential cards and coins.
* Chanel Long Zipped Wallet: While not strictly a "coin purse card holder," some longer zipped wallets from Chanel might feature a dedicated coin compartment alongside card slots, offering a blend of functionalities.
Deciphering the Price: Chanel Wallet Original Price and Market Fluctuations
The original price of a Chanel coin purse card holder varies depending on the specific design, materials, and year of release. However, you can generally expect to find these pieces in the range of $800 to $1,200 or more. This price point reflects the superior quality of the materials, the meticulous craftsmanship, and the enduring value associated with the Chanel brand. The price on the pre-owned market can fluctuate based on condition, rarity, and demand. Factors such as the presence of the iconic quilted leather, the hardware finish (gold or silver), and the overall condition of the piece all influence its resale value.
